Will purely depend on what production chains you are going to invest in. Sheep offer a great return when turning the wool into fabric at the spinnery then clothes at the tailors. Also they are cheap to feed.

Cows can be used to turn the milk into cheese and butter at the dairy and are also needed if you also want to make cakes at the bakery. You can also sell use the slurry and manure at the biogas plant. Cows are a lot more work intense than sheep.

I currently have a cow barn with 80 cows and they are providing enough milk to supply my dairy without it running out. I have butter and cheese making constantly. My next move will to be expanding my farm with a sugar factory so I can also start making chocolate.

Chickens like always don't earn great money but egss needed for making cakes. Pigs cost lots to feed due to all the different maount of food types they require, purely sold for meat so they are a slow return. I hear horse are not as profitable as they used to be.
